What is Sports Betting?

Sports betting is the activity of placing a wager on the outcome of a sporting event and predicting sports results. The frequency of sports bet upon varies by culture, with the vast majority of bets being placed on association football, American football, basketball, baseball, hockey, track cycling, auto racing, mixed martial arts, and boxing at both the amateur and professional levels.

The legality of sports betting in the United States is complicated by the fact that there is no federal law that specifically addresses the legality of sports gambling. However, there are a number of federal laws that do have an impact on the legality of sports betting in the US. These include the Federal Wire Act, the Unlawful Internet Gambling Enforcement Act, and the Professional and Amateur Sports Protection Act.

What is the relationship between Cryptocurrency and Sports Betting?

The relationship between cryptocurrency and sports betting is a complex one. On the one hand, cryptocurrency can be used to facilitate sports betting by allowing bettors to place bets using digital currency. On the other hand, the volatile nature of cryptocurrency prices could make sports betting using digital currency a risky proposition. 토토

The use of cryptocurrency in sports betting has a number of advantages. First, cryptocurrency transactions are typically fast and cheap. This is important for bettors who want to place bets on live sporting events, as they can do so without having to worry about the delay caused by traditional methods like bank transfers. Second, cryptocurrency offers bettors a degree of anonymity. This is because most cryptocurrency transactions are pseudonymous, meaning that the identities of the parties involved are not revealed. This can be beneficial for both recreational and professional bettors who want to keep their activities private.

However, there are also a number of risks associated with using cryptocurrency for sports betting. First, as mentioned above, the price of cryptocurrencies is highly volatile. This means that the value of a bet placed in digital currency can fluctuate significantly before the event takes place. This can result in bettors either winning or losing a large amount of money depending on the timing of their bet.

Second, there is the risk that the sportsbook or betting exchange that is facilitating the bet may itself be unregulated or located in a jurisdiction where sports betting is illegal. This could lead to bettors having their funds confiscated or being unable to withdraw their winnings. Finally, there is the risk that the digital currency used for betting could be subject to theft or fraud. This is a risk that is present with any type of online transaction, but it is worth being aware of when using cryptocurrency.
